NAME
       dwww-convert - convert files to HTML for dwww

SYNOPSIS
       dwww-convert [--no-path-info] type location

DESCRIPTION
       dwww-convert  is  part of the dwww package, which provides access to on-
       line documentation on a Debian system via  WWW.   dwww-convert  converts
       documentation  to  HTML  so  that  it  can be viewed with a WWW browser.
       dwww-convert is usually run by the WWW server, but can also  be  run  by
       hand.

       The type argument gives the type of the file, one of:

       file   An  arbitrary  file;  the type is guessed using simple heuristics
              based on the filename.

       dir    A directory.  If the directory contains the  file  index.html  or
              index.htm that file will be returned. Otherwise, A listing of the
              files in the directory is generated.

       html   An HTML file.  The file is returned as is.

       man    A  manual page.  The location is the pathname of the nroff source
              file.

       runman A manual page.  The location is the name of the manual  page  and
              its  section,  separated  by  a slash.  For example, the location
              would be intro/1 to refer to the intro(1) manual page.

       info   An Info file.

       text   A plain text file (using the ISO-8859-1 character set).

       An unknown file type is treated as text.

       The location argument gives the filename of the file.  The name must  be
       complete,  i.e., it must start at the root directory (/).  The name must
       not contain any symbolic links (cf.  realpath(1)).  The file must be lo-
       cated in or below a directory that has been allowed by the system admin-
       istrator; see dwww(7) for more info.

       The file may be compressed with gzip(1) or bzip2(1).  It is uncompressed
       automatically and invisibly.  Compression is  indicated  by  a  filename
       that ends in `.gz' or `.bz2'.

OPTIONS
       --no-path-info
              Internal option used by the dwww's CGI script to let dwww-convert
              know,  that  the  arguments following the option do not come from
              the PATH_INFO variable, but from the QUERY_STRING.

FILES
       /etc/dwww/dwww.conf
              Configuration file for dwww.  See dwww(7) for more information.
